Description

Novel building template
Technical Field
The utility model relates to a building technical field especially relates to a novel building templates.
Background
The aluminum formwork is an aluminum formwork for concrete pouring forming, and comprises a wood formwork, a plywood formwork and the like besides the aluminum formwork, the aluminum formwork is widely applied to building engineering by the characteristics of repeated use, light weight, attractive appearance of concrete pouring forming and the like, but when the existing aluminum formwork is disassembled after use, concrete on the aluminum formwork is not easy to fall off, and when the temperature is low, the concrete and the aluminum formwork are frozen, so that the concrete and the aluminum formwork are more difficult to separate.

Detailed Description
The technical scheme of the invention is further explained by combining the attached drawings as follows:
as shown in fig. 1-2, a novel building template comprises a frame 1 and a main board 3, the main board 3 is fixedly installed on the front side of the frame 1, the frame 1 is used for supporting and fixing, the main board 3 comprises a contact board 301 and a reinforcing board 302, the contact board 301 is located on the front side of the reinforcing board 302, the reinforcing board 302 is honeycomb-shaped, the main board on the market is aluminum material, when the temperature is below 0 ℃, the aluminum template is difficult to separate from the concrete, the aluminum material is replaced by polyethylene and polypropylene, the problem that the concrete is difficult to separate from the main board is effectively solved, the stability is ensured, the mass of the aluminum template on the market per square meter is 18-25 kg, the utility model has 15 kg per square meter, the honeycomb-shaped structural strength of the reinforcing board 302 is high, the connecting holes 2 are formed on the side wall of the frame 1, the connecting holes 2 are used for placing bolts or other connecting parts, the supporting board 4 is, backup pad 4 is used for strengthening to support fixedly, integrated into one piece has the sand grip on the 1 lateral wall of frame, the sand grip is convenient for take and put the frame, the material of frame 1 is aluminium, aluminium material intensity is high and the quality is lighter, the material of contact plate 301 is polyethylene, the material of gusset plate 302 is polypropylene, the inside glass fiber that alternately arranges of gusset plate 302, the effectual intensity that strengthens the mainboard, stability and bearing capacity have been improved, the inside integrated into one piece of backup pad 4 has strengthening rib 401, the thickness of 1 frame of frame is 0.8cm, the bearing effect has been strengthened.
The working principle is as follows: when the combined frame is used, the adjacent frames 1 are fixedly connected through bolts or other connecting parts, concrete is poured after the adjacent frames 1 are fixed, and the frames 1 are taken down after the concrete is fixed and formed.
